Carlos Vives remembers his life in Santa Marta and Bogotá, Colombia. It was there that his artistic sensitivity turned into a reality. In an intimate way, he recalls the importance his father and brother had for his early musical training and the songs of the travelling artists who visited his home, which have forever been an inspiration for him. Carlos talks about the voices of the street which have left his songs with a particular tonality thanks to which he has managed to place Colombian music at the very top of the global scene.

The improbable real life of Rafael Escalona, who had no music education and became Colombia's king of vallenato music, chronicling everyday life.
Is a Colombian singer, actor and composer, recognized in Latin America and other parts of the world for mixing Colombian music such as cumbia and vallenato with pop and rock. He has won two Grammy Awards and 14 Latin Grammy Awards.
